NCT ID: NCT00829959
Eligibility Criteria: Inclusion Criteria: 1. Women who have been referred to the Clinical Cancer Genetics Program for discussion of Hereditary Breast And Ovarian Syndrome (HBOC). 2. Participants must be seen by clinical cancer geneticist and undergo genetic counseling here at M.D. Anderson Cancer Center for HBOC. 3. Participants may or may not have a personal diagnosis of cancer. 4. Participants may have already seen or undergone reproductive endocrine evaluation and had any reproductive treatment. 5. The participant must be a woman and have reproductive potential which would include either active menstruation, blood tests with premenopausal ranges of Luteinizing Hormone (LH), Follicle Stimulating Hormone (FSH) and estradiol, or was premenopausal prior to starting chemotherapy for a diagnosed breast cancer. 6. Age \>/= 18 years old 7. The patient must be able to speak and read fluently in either English or in Spanish in order to complete the questionnaire. Exclusion Criteria: 1\) None
